Overview
Located in Madrid City Centre, this hotel is within walking distance of Plaza de Oriente, Plaza de Espana and Royal Palace of Madrid. It is close to Puerta del Sol, eateries and shops.
A car rental desk, a concierge and a 24-hour reception are just some of the available services at Cason del Tormes. Additionally, the multilingual staff are on hand to provide local information.
Casón del Tormes provides spacious rooms equipped with cable/satellite channels, a hair dryer and a refrigerator. They each offer heating, a telephone and a private bathroom.
Cason del Tormes Hotel Madrid's on-site eatery is an ideal option for guests wishing to dine in. Those wanting to unwind with a drink can try out the in-house bar.
Madrid-Barajas Airport is around a 20-minute car ride from Cason del Tormes and Sol Metro Station is within walking distance. The hotel is also located near the area's well-known clubs and pubs, and Plaza Mayor and Gran Via are a 20-minute stroll away.
